html { font-family: Tahoma , Verdana; font-size: 10pt; }
table { font-family: Tahoma, Verdana; font-size: 10pt; }

body{
	background-image:url(images/tph_bg.jpg);
	background-repeat:no-repeat;
	background-position:50% 0;
	background-color:#000000;
}

a.main_nav
{
font-size:14px;
color: #CCCCCC;
text-decoration:none;
padding:7px 5px;
display:block;
}

div#front_news_block{
	padding-top:10px;
	margin-bottom:0;
	padding-bottom:10px;
	//padding-bottom:8px;
}

a.member_button
{
border: 1px solid #000000;
}


a.main_nav:hover
{
text-decoration:underline;
color: #CCCCCC;
}

a.main_nav_on
{
font-size:11px;
color: #FFFFFF;
height: 20px;
text-decoration:none;
padding:7px;
}

.front_right_box
{
padding: 10px;
color: #000000;
display: block;
}




.padding
{
padding: 10px;

}

div.borderedPane{
	margin:10px;
	border:1px solid #CD2D35;
	background-color:#FFFFFF;
}

#content, #submenu, .front_page{
	background-image:url(images/trans_white.png);
	background-repeat:repeat;
}

.main_content
{
padding: 10px;
}

a.sub_nav
{
font-size: 11px;
text-decoration:none;
color: #000099;
}

a.sub_nav:hover
{
text-decoration:none;
color: #666666;
}

a.front_news_link
{
font-size: 12px;
padding-top: 7px;
padding-bottom: 7px;
padding-left: 8px;
padding-right: 8px;
color: #00045B;
display:block;
text-decoration:none;
}



a.front_news_link:hover
{
color: #2A30B7;
}

a.m_nav
{
font-size: 11px;
color: #FFFFFF;
display:block;
text-decoration:none;
}
a.m_nav:hover
{
color: #666666;
}
/* slider */
#slider ul, #slider li{
	margin:0;
	padding:0;
	list-style:none;
}
#slider, #slider li{ 
	width:680px;
	height:383px;
	overflow:hidden; 
}
span#prevBtn{
	position:absolute;
	top:0;
	left:0;
}
span#nextBtn{
	position:absolute;
	top:0;
	right:0;
}
div#slider, div#slider ul li{
	width:680px;
	height:383px;
	border:0;
}
div#slider img{
	width:680px;
	height:510px;
	margin-top:-64px;
	border:0;
}
div#slider{
	border: 1px #333333 solid;
	position:relative;
}
ol#controls{
	z-index:60;
	margin-top:-30px;
	position:absolute;
	margin-left:237px;
}
ol#controls li{
	list-style:none;
	float:left;
	width:20px;
	height:19px;
	margin-right:7px;
}
ol#controls li a{
	height:19px;
	display:block;
}
ol#controls li img{
	width:20px;
	height:19px;
	border:0;
}
div#slider div.content{
	margin-top:-198px;
	height:140px;
	background-image:url(images/trans_black.png);
	background-repeat:repeat;
	color:#ffffff;
	z-index:50;
	position:relative;
	padding: 0 10px 0 10px;
}
/*li#controls4{
	margin:0!important;
}
li#controls5{
	float:right!important;
	margin:0!important;
}
/*div#slider{
	margin-top:10px;
}*/
div#slider div.content h2{
	padding-top:10px;
	font-size:14px;
}
div#slider div.content a{
	color:#ffffff;
	text-decoration:none!important;
}
div#slider div.content a:hover{
	text-decoration:underline;
}
div#slider a.more{
	position:absolute;
	right:10px;
	top:95px;
	font-size:10px;
}
/* end of slider */


